BRAZIL TO AID: POOR PEOPLE Cost of Living Is Very High in Southern Country RIO DE JANEIRO, May 2.—Ef- forts being made by the Brazilian government to reduce living costs, which have doubled within two years, are considered by many as somewhat socialistic but, nevertheless, are get- ting results. Bearing in mind the truism that “hunger breads revolution,” the gov- ernment has taken steps to regulate transport and supply and to adopt other measures in an effort to minim. ize the position of the population. The cost of living in this country, generally thought of as a jand of plen- ty, has increased to such an extent that today the cost of bread, for a family of three would have covered all food costs for that family a years ago. Even coffee, Brazil's one great source of wealth, went up 10 per cent in price in less than a month recently, and every other commodity has risen in proportion. Profiteering 1s largely responsible for the present high cost of living in this country, especially high in Rio de Janeiro and other large cities along the coast. Transport conditions also come in for a good share of re- sponsibility in the elevated living costs, The government is forcing whole- salers and retailers to declare their stocks of food with a view of break- ing up hoarding.
